Downside Abbey is the senior Benedictine monastery of the English Benedictine Congregation. The buildings and grounds were developed by the Community of St Gregory the Great (originally founded in Douai in 1606) after it settled at Downside in 1814.

The Abbey Church (the minor Basilica of St. Gregory the Great) is one of only four minor basilicas in the UK and is one of England’s great neo-Gothic churches. The grade one listed building is work of several distinguished architects including Thomas Garner, Sir Ninian Comper and Sir Giles Gilbert Scott.

Between 12.20 -13.15 renowned organist Nigel Kerry will perform pieces by past members of the Community (e.g. Dom Alphege Shebbeare, Dom Thomas Symons and Dom Gregory Murray) on the abbey organ, the largest instrument built by the firm of John Compton.

Our exhibition 'Everyday Lives' explores the lives of some of the people who worked at Downside as domestic servants or on the wider estate and looks at some of the ways the Community affected the lives of local people.
